Overview

Medcan is building new digital experiences for clients to help them live happier, healthier lives. We are seeking a talented Salesforce Developer to join our growing team within the Technology Services Team—a group supporting clients and employees on healthcare, business management technology, cybersecurity, and infrastructure. The role involves working with multiple Salesforce Clouds (Sales, Service, Health, Experience) and downstream systems such as Workday and our EMR.

You will be part of an award‑winning, inclusive, problem‑solving team that values collaboration and innovative solutions.

Responsibilities
  • Progressively learn Medcan operations and the broader healthcare field.
  • Design and implement systems in Salesforce to support automation of CRM, IT, and customer support processes.
  • Participate in storyboard and solution design sessions – recommend alternative approaches and best practices, define technical impact, and provide sizing estimates.
  • Participate in the full SDLC from technical design to development, testing and deployment.
  • Design, build, test and deploy Salesforce Platform solutions including point‑and‑click configurations, workflows, flows, APEX triggers, custom web services, Visual Force pages, Lightning (Aura and LWC).
  • Design and build interfaces between Salesforce Platform and other applications.
  • Provide support and administrative assistance for existing Salesforce applications.
  • Participate in estimation and timeline processes.
Qualifications
  • SFDC Platform Developer I certification (minimum).
  • 7+ years of experience as a Salesforce Developer with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, Health Cloud, and Experience Cloud.
  • Marketing Cloud experience is a bonus.
  • Excellent overall development skills throughout the SDLC with a preference for Agile methodology.
  • Knowledge of Web Services, REST, XML and outbound messaging.
  • Development experience with Apex, Visualforce, web services, Lightning components, Azure/.Net/ JavaScript competencies.
  • Demonstrated ability to deliver well‑structured and documented code.
  • Experience with Salesforce Dev Ops tools (e.g., Salesforce DX, Git, Bitbucket, VSCode).
  • Experience working on and deploying complex enterprise‑level solutions.
  • Highly organized, deadline‑driven individual with a “can do” attitude.
  • Ability to support internal resources that require Salesforce education and support.
  • Empathetic teammates who lead with kindness and positivity (people person).
  • Bonus: SFDC Platform Developer II certification, Platform App Builder, Service, Sales or other consultant certifications.
  • Experience running Dev Ops and release management.
  • Experience in a technology company or start‑up environment a plus.
  • Experience interfacing with business and technical teams.
  • UX/UI design training.
  • Experience with ETL tools (at least one of: Dell Boomi, Azure, Informatica, Oracle Data Integrator, MS SSIS), data migration and data cleansing.
